What is 76/12 Divided By 4/2

Answer: 7612÷42\frac{76}{12}\div\frac{4}{2} = 196\frac{19}{6}

Solving 7612÷42\frac{76}{12}\div\frac{4}{2}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

7612÷42=7612×24\frac{76}{12} \div \frac{4}{2} = \frac{76}{12} \times \frac{2}{4}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 76×2=15276 \times 2 = 152
  • Multiply the Denominators: 12×4=4812 \times 4 = 48
  • Form the New Fraction: 7612×42=15248\frac{76}{12} \times \frac{4}{2} = \frac{152}{48}

Let's Simplify 15248\frac{152}{48}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 152152 and 4848. The GCD of 152152 and 4848 is 88.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:152÷848÷8=196\frac{152 \div 8}{48 \div 8} = \frac{19}{6}

Answer 7612÷42=196\frac{76}{12}\div\frac{4}{2} = \frac{19}{6}
